Output 8ea502dfcae9c784c88d68ea18d09bbef234bc54745ded22d4fbaadc8d9fe28f:1

value
2140661
script pubkey
OP_0 OP_PUSHBYTES_20 bca85580111b9a248c158f9ad5a8b344ba7b19e4
address
bc1qhj59tqq3rwdzfrq437ddt29ngja8kx0yv44kjl
transaction
8ea502dfcae9c784c88d68ea18d09bbef234bc54745ded22d4fbaadc8d9fe28f
confirmations
150206
spent
true